Buying Guide

Key Purchase Considerations

When selecting a portable bike pump, consider how you ride, where you ride, and what tires you typically maintain. For urban commuting with cars and bikes, a cordless pump with a high PSI ceiling (120–150 PSI) and built-in battery is ideal, enabling fast inflation without searching for a power outlet. For road riders and mountain bikers, valve compatibility (Presta and Schrader), a reliable gauge, and a compact form factor matter most. If you frequently inflate balls or inflatable toys, look for multiple modes or a custom preset for specific target pressures. Portability, battery life, and charging options (Type-C) also shape convenience on longer trips.

  • PSI range and inflation speed vs. battery burn
  • Valve compatibility: Presta, Schrader, or both
  • Auto shut-off and preset pressure options
  • Size, weight, and included storage solutions

Corded vs. Cordless Tradeoffs

Cordless inflators offer true on-the-go convenience, freeing you from a 12V outlet. They typically rely on built-in rechargeable batteries, with runtimes measured in minutes or the number of tires inflated per charge. Corded or hose-connected models can deliver sustained power but require access to a power source. If you ride in areas with limited charging opportunities, prioritize products with longer battery life and a reliable USB-C or Type-C charging option. For occasional use, a compact device with a power bank compatibility can be enough.

Valve Adaptability and Accessories

Most portable pumps include Presta/Schrader adapters and a built-in hose, which simplifies the process of inflating different tire types. A pump with a flexible hose can reach awkward valve positions, while a built-in gauge reduces the need for separate tools. Accessories such as a carrying bag, mounting bracket, or frame cradle improve readiness on rides. When selecting, verify that the included adapters match your tires (bikes, scooters, or exercise balls) and that the gauge provides clear, precise readings.

Durability, Calibration, and Maintenance

Durability matters for gear that travels in pockets, panniers, or saddle bags. Look for a robust housing, a stable stand or nozzle locking mechanism, and a calibration option if the gauge reading drifts. Regularly check seals, connectors, and the hose for wear. If you notice inaccurate readings, some models offer calibration steps to recalibrate the gauge, ensuring consistency across inflations. A lightweight but sturdy pump will resist impact during storage or transit and serve longer through many cycling seasons.

Usage Scenarios And Performance Profiles

Different riders require different performance profiles. Casual riders may favor compact models with straightforward operation and a quick inflation pace, while performance cyclists might prioritize higher PSI, faster inflations, and longer battery life. Mountain bikers benefit from versatile valve compatibility and a built-in hose for on-trail use, whereas commuters might prefer a pump with a bright LED light for night repairs. Consider your typical ride length, storage space, and whether you need a pump primarily for tires or for inflating sports equipment as well.
